In what way is the Wii more powerful? This is just an Android emulator box, admittedly I haven't seen specs, but Android N64 emulators have worked damn well for years, while the Wii one is iffy at best. Not to mention the fact that this'll output HDMI, the Wii maxes out at component. Once you factor in the price of controller adapters, there's not much price difference, plus the Retron 5 has cartridge slots!

The Wii was/is a rad emulation machine, especially for the price you can get a used one at these days, but the Retron 5 should end up being significantly more powerful and useful, though of course it'll cost more.
